I can see how this would work out - obviously the motivation issue is an important one, but for people who have very little good sense of time, like me, having a two-minute tune playing for brushing teeth would actually be helpful - you keep going until the song quits. Simple enough. With this tech, it still goes to the inner ear (or at least claims to), which says it's going to be heard rather than felt. Where it's coming from could be very disorienting. I'd say, though, this has as much chance of carrying the subliminal as any other audio stream.
Thing is, you'd better like the song you pick for at least as long as you intend on using the toothbrush. I can see this as being something that kills popular tunes through over-saturation. It doesn't play music directly to your brain, its the exact same thing as how you hear yourself talk. It transfers the sound up the jaw bone to the inner ear. So yes I guess you could plant a subliminal message in it, the same way you can plant one in anything you can hear.
